Servings: 4
Servings: 4
Ingredients
- 2 cups - Canola Oil
- 2 - Green Plantains
- 1 teaspoon - Table Salt
Steps
- subheading: Tostones:
- Peel the green plantains by using a pairing knife to score the skin vertically. Continue making scores about 1 inch apart. Now peel each strip of skin off. You can use the knife to remove any bits still stuck onto the plantain.
- Now let's cut the plantain in about 1 inch chunks. Usually the average plantain should yield about 5 to 6 chunks.
- Prepare the deep fryer by adding enough oil that it reaches about 2 inches of the pot. Bring the oil temperature up to 350 degrees F.
- Drop the plantains into the oil for about 7 mins.
- Remove and let the excess oil drain in a strainer.
- Once cool to the touch, we need to squish the plantains, You can use a tostonera (we recomend using a ziplock bag for easy removal) or even a can to squish them down. If you want thin and crispy tostones then apply more pressure. If you like them chunkier then apply less pressure.
- Raise the oil temperature to 400 degrees F. Drop about 6 to 7 of the squished plantains for its final fry. Fry for about 1.5 minutes.
- Once removed from the fryer, lightly season with salt.
- Let the tostones cool and drain in a strainer.
